Pioneers

英音[ ˌpaɪəˈnɪəs ] 美音[ ˌpaɪəˈnɪr ]
先锋
常用释义
n. 拓荒者;先锋(pioneer 的复数)
v. 做先锋,倡导;开辟(道路)(pioneer 的第三人称单数)
